No-fault divorces in Idaho reach resolution faster than fault-based divorces because the spouses don't have to argue about or prove who was responsible for the divorce. There are two no-fault grounds for divorce in Idaho: irreconcilable differences and. living separate and apart for five years without cohabitation.

How Long Does a Divorce Take in Idaho? The average time to complete a contested divorce in Idaho can take six or more months to resolve. The timeline can vary after your spouse is served with divorce papers; the waiting period typically is 21 days. The process can take longer than this time.
Filing for divorce involves several important steps you will need to follow to ensure that you abide by Idaho's procedure. The 2022 court filing fee is $207 and the waiting period to receive a final divorce decree from an Idaho court is a minimum of 21 days after the filing and service of process.
To proceed with a legal separation, you and your spouse must file a petition with the court. You must also serve this petition on your spouse or another adult who lives with your spouse. Once you file the petition, the court will grant you and your spouse a hearing date to appear before a judge.
